Composite Melt-blown Filtration Material is suitable for manufacturing various filter layers, such as automotive air-conditioning filters, vacuum cleaner filters and various household air purifier filters.
Composite Melt-blown Filtration Material Market Summary
According to the new market research report “Composite Melt-blown Filtration Material - Global Market Share and Ranking, Overall Sales and Demand Forecast 2024-2030”, published by QYResearch, the global Composite Melt-blown Filtration Material market size is projected to reach USD 0.81 billion by 2030, at a CAGR of 5.5% during the forecast period.

According to QYResearch Top Players Research Center, the global key manufacturers of Composite Melt-blown Filtration Material include Berry Global, Kimberly-Clark, H&V, Monadnock Non-Wovens, Mitsui Chemicals, SWM, Toray, Lydall, Fitesa, Don & Low, etc. In 2023, the global top 10 players had a share approximately 76.0% in terms of revenue.
Market Drivers:
D1: Higher filtration efficiency materials continue to be a big driver.
D2: Another driver is filtration material in automotive industry. A couple of decades ago, car cabin air filters were not a standard feature. Now they are included to benefit the air quality of the people in the car. As a result, the market is only going to pick up as consumers begin to expect air filtration as a standard feature in new vehicles.
D3: Studies in recent years have shown that glass fibers are easy to break and fall off, which is harmful to the human body and may even cause cancer. The World Health Organization IARC classifies glass fiber as IB, which is a possible carcinogen. In addition, the glass fiber cannot be electretized with electrostatic charge, so as time goes by, the application of melt blown filter materials will become more and more widespread.
Restraint:
R1: It continues to revolve around education. Most consumers and even business users aren’t familiar with the air filters they use. They often don’t think about filters having to be changed which may have larger implications such as equipment failure.This will therefore affect the melt-blown filtration material industry.
R2: Melt blowing is a non-steady state process, and the production process control is more complicated. Although the principle of melt blown spinning is clear and the main structure of the equipment is also clear, many key technologies and production process control are basically not controlled by equipment manufacturers. Mastered, these key technologies affect the quality of products and the internal structure of materials, and are directly related to the application and promotion environment of the products.
R3: In recent years, melt-blown nonwoven technology has developed rapidly, and various raw materials that can be used in melt-blown are constantly emerging, and melt-blown production technology is also rapidly developing and improving (such as melt-blown nanofiber production technology and melt-blown two-component technology, etc.) All these have brought development and challenges to the meltblown nonwoven industry.
